Family planning office set ablaze

Published February 27, 2007

TIMERGARA, Feb 26: An office of the Health Department’s Family Planning Project in the Wari area of Upper Dir was set on fire late on Sunday night.

Police told Dawn on Monday that some people entered the office, sprayed its walls and doors with kerosene oil and set it ablaze.

The entire office and family planning medicines and contraceptives worth thousands of rupees were gutted.

Police have registered a case and are investigating.
